Hey — handover notes on the Tollgate session-token refresh bug before your first on-call week. Short version: tokens issued near the refresh window sometimes get refreshed twice, and the second refresh invalidates the first, logging users out mid-session. Marek's mutex fix is merged but gated behind a flag we haven't flipped in prod yet. Don't touch the flag without checking the current auth service settings, copied below.

service settings:
[casax]
port = 6379
team = rusir
host = casax.zemvarhq.corp
region = outer-4
access_code = ac_9808ce
timeout_ms = 1500

## ScanDock Barcode Integration

The ScanDock service receives scan events from warehouse handhelds and writes them to the inventory ledger database. Events are batched every two seconds; duplicates are filtered by scan token. Contractors working on the decoder module only need read access to the ledger tables. To inspect recent scan batches, connect with the connection string below.

replica DSN, yahaf-yagaf: mongodb://tamath_svc:a2netSk3RZMuTj@db-d084.novacsoft.internal:5432/ralmir

## Releases

QuickSeek index builds are cut weekly. If on-call gets paged for slow autocomplete, first check whether the active index is stale — rollbacks pin the previous build automatically. To ship a hotfix index, run the packager, verify the latency benchmark passes, and sign the artifact before upload. The packager reads the signing key shown below.

rollout seal: bky4_x7Gc

## Deploying the Gatewick Proctor Queue

Deploys are pretty painless: push to main, wait for the pipeline, then watch the queue drain dashboard for five minutes. If candidates pile up mid-exam, roll back first and ask questions later — the queue replays safely. Everything the workers care about lives in one config block, shown here for reference.

settings of bafof-yagef:
JOROX_PIN=8740
JOROX_TENANT=pelox
JOROX_METRICS_HOST=metrics.jorox.qorvelworks.internal
JOROX_SEAL=seal_c78f63c1
JOROX_STANDBY_TEAM=norax